I work in PA but live in Ohio.
PA has pretty strict beer rules. It took a petition for one of our large chain gas stations to sell beer. It passed but it wasnt given to all locations.
In Ohio i can buy Four Lokos and many wine brands at the local gas stations. I can buy beer at each of the 3 Dollar Generals and both save a lots within 5 minutes from my front door. However it takes a distributor or a restaurant to sell hard liquor. I believe what keeps each of them going is what brands they carry, gas prices, or other items the store carries.
